I bleed mine in the bath, it's the easiest way I think.
Fill the bath with water. (Or just use a bucket) Take the brake off of the bike. Put the brake in the water. Undo the grub screw on the lever. (Underwater) Undo the bolt on the slave. (Again, underwater) Pull the lever once and you should see air bubbles in the water. Keep pulling the lever until no more air comes out of the brake, Do up both of the bolts underwater. And you should have a nice feeling brake. :P
